Greenwich Overview
Greenwich is a town in Fairfield County, Connecticut with a population of 61,171. It is the largest town on Connecticut's Gold Coast, and this area hosts many hedge funds and financial service companies, which make finding a job relatively easy and there are also a wide variety of apartments in Greenwich, which is the southernmost and westernmost city in New England.

How is the weather in Greenwich?
Weather in Greenwich varies throughout the year. The city gets 49 inches of rain per annum, compared to the U.S. average of 39. They get 30 inches of snow or more each year versus the national average of 26 inches per year. It rains or snows 79 days out of the year and experiences 190 sunny days on average. In July, the high is 84 degrees, with a corresponding January low of 23 degrees.
How do I get around town?
The town's transit system is advanced, and transportation is reasonable. The Metro-North Railroad's New Haven Line is approximately a 50-minute train ride to Grand Central Terminal in Manhattan, making commuting to the city fast and easy. The Amtrak Acela, Northeast Regional, and Vermonter trains stop in nearby Stamford.

What Greenwich landmarks should I see?
Landmarks in Greenwich include The Great Captain Island Lighthouse and Putnam Cottage. The Lighthouse is located on Great Captain Island, off the coast of Greenwich. The 17.2-acre island is part of a cluster of islands including Little Captain and Wee Captain Islands. Putnam House is associated with General Israel Putnam, who heroically escaped from the British during the Revolutionary War.
What is there to do around Greenwich?
Here are some of the best things to do in Greenwich. The Bruce Museum by Greenwich Harbor has both science and art exhibits. Its artifacts include the fields of decorative art, anthropology, fine art and natural history. The Bush-Holley House is where the first art colony in Connecticut sprouted up and is also the former home of American Impressionist art. It now houses the Greenwich Historical Society. Tours are available and worthwhile. Todd's point in Old Greenwich is was formerly the water-front estate of Innis Arden, which belonged to wealthy New Yorker J. Kennedy Tod. Greenwich Point Park has fantastic beaches with long walking trails.
